Output 6e395c75ee426ba17acc3892af22e7d65e92309d8574f8062421c87b54fe2d87:0

value
7500
script pubkey
OP_0 OP_PUSHBYTES_32 5efec5dad21923a92054b374275abe54025817460dd259fca59ca55d7617ab6d
address
tb1qtmlvtkkjry36jgz5kd6zwk472sp9s96xphf9nl99njj46ash4dksl22pku
transaction
6e395c75ee426ba17acc3892af22e7d65e92309d8574f8062421c87b54fe2d87
confirmations
31258
spent
true